SDK versions
These versions target
@stellar/stellar-sdk >=17 <18. The published Lookup package includes the fresh testnet preset above. Universal Lookup is the default read path. Missing Lookup configuration throws CONFIG; it never silently selects direct Resolver reads. Deliberate direct mode only supports the compatible native path.

Fresh namespace and older deployment
The newnova belongs to GAAHFS7CISNAJOQK5VS447NS6ZFPRLLQQP6IM2EA4W7XZWGJNMXZ4VLK. It is reclaimable and unlocked, not permanent. The bootstrap reserved claim was exempt from the public claim fee. Existing old namespace records were not migrated automatically.
The old Registry CAUEHYVLLNNDZ4H5QWCPBDWEONRI44SI3XYSEACB4U3HYILIVQGQAMNI and old Primary CAZMXB6UBXKL4DGC2GUC5VKHIZMF47CIZXZFAZPYLM2RP6ZJZNSIIYS2 remain separate deployments. Do not mix their IDs or records with the new setup.
Allocator schema 4 is not an in-place migration of schema 3 unpaid claims. A locked old Resolver does not gain memos through an SDK change. An unchanged contract ID or ABI version does not prove unchanged executable code; see governance.
Testnet resets can remove accounts and contracts. Recheck configuration after a reset; Stellar documents network differences and resets. Example names do not promise a particular holder or live record.
